2. SURVEY OVERVIEW
■ Started 18th January 2016
■ Understanding current contributions, any barriers, and need for
improved coordination and support
■ 438 responses to date
■ 146 working in global health
– NHS 98, Academia 24, Not-for-profit 18, Other (Royal Colleges,
Scottish Government) 6
3. DIVERSITY
Nurses, GPs, surgeons, NHS managers, public health practitioners, midwives,
obstetricians…
Education (87), Training (74), Project work (53), Research (45), Mentoring (37)
Working in more than 50 countries. Top 10:
Malawi 52 India 21
Uganda 21 Kenya 18
Sierra Leone 18 Zambia 19
Tanzania 16 Rwanda 13
Nepal 13 Ghana 10
